Tejanos faced several obstacles inside their endeavours to engage in the politics on the nineteenth century. Anglos regarded as them unworthy of the franchise and customarily discouraged them from voting. Where permitted to Forged ballots, Tejanos ended up closely monitored by Anglo political bosses or their lieutenants to make certain they voted for precise candidates and platforms.

Chapa turned a revered pharmacist while in the Westside, but he was ideal known for his political activities. From 1888 to 1906 Chapa served as being a member from the area board of education and learning. He was also elected alderman [town council member] and served for at least two phrases. He was the publisher of El Imparcial de Texas, a conservative Spanish-language newspaper, that was favorable on the Mexican dictator Porfirio Diaz.
